Privacy-focused blockchain Zano has activated its sixth hard fork, HF6, at block height 3,833,000, with the upgrade now live on mainnet. The network described it as the largest upgrade in its seven-year history. HF6 introduces Gateway Addresses, a feature designed for centralized exchanges, DEXs and cross-chain bridges that offers a directly traceable single balance and instant synchronization while keeping existing addresses and their privacy model unchanged. The upgrade also allows native ZANO to move in a non-custodial manner to Ethereum, Solana and TON. Once on those external networks, the asset is public; when bridged back to Zano, its privacy protections return. Beyond cross-chain changes, HF6 tightens consensus validation rules and strengthens wallet encryption, mining pool fault tolerance, payment IDs, anti-DoS limits, SOCKS5 proxy support and RPC interfaces. HF6 is also described as a prerequisite for the Zano Execution Layer, an EVM-compatible chain still under development with no fixed launch date. Zano’s next-generation consensus protocol, Zenith, has been placed on the project’s 2027 roadmap.
